Tech for Good is a meetup group for people interested in using technology to tackle social issues, from large-scale social change and inequalities, to local civic participation and community building. We bring together people with lived experience and understanding of social issues together with hackers, coders, developers and designers.
This session theme is – Digital Leadership.
Digital Leadership is about making the internet for everyone. For that to happen, our public, civic and business leaders need to become digital leaders - not just so that they can manage specifically digital programmes and projects, but so that they can make sure their entire organisations are relevant and effective in a digital age.
Technology is not change itself; it enables the change that is so trans formative. It is about a change of working, a change of culture – changes that are made possible by digital technology.
